Chlorella: A Closer Look at Liver Health

Chlorella is a type of green freshwater algae that is widely marketed as a dietary supplement due to its rich nutritional profile, containing protein, vitamins, minerals, and antioxidants. Many users turn to chlorella for its purported detoxifying properties and overall health benefits, including liver support. While a growing body of research supports chlorella's potential advantages for liver health, it is crucial to examine the full picture, including potential risks and side effects, particularly regarding the liver.

How Chlorella Supports Liver Function

Rather than causing harm, studies have consistently shown that chlorella may actually support and protect the liver. Several mechanisms contribute to this effect:

  • Antioxidant Action: Chlorella is packed with antioxidants like chlorophyll, beta-carotene, and vitamin C, which help neutralize free radicals and reduce oxidative stress. This is vital for the liver, which is heavily involved in metabolic processes that can produce free radicals.
  • Detoxification Aid: A key function of chlorella is its ability to bind to heavy metals and other toxins, facilitating their removal from the body. This reduces the burden on the liver, allowing it to function more efficiently. Animal studies, for example, have shown that chlorella can help mitigate liver damage from heavy metal toxicity.
  • Improvement in Fatty Liver Disease: In human clinical trials, chlorella supplementation has been shown to improve markers of liver health in patients with non-alcoholic fatty liver disease (NAFLD). Participants experienced significant reductions in liver enzymes (like AST) and improvements in blood sugar and lipid profiles.
  • Reduction of Inflammation: Chlorella's anti-inflammatory properties can help reduce liver inflammation, which is a key factor in conditions like NAFLD.

Potential Risks and What to Watch For

While direct evidence of chlorella causing liver damage in a non-contaminated state is scarce, there are specific risks and side effects to be aware of. The most significant threat comes from contaminated products.

Potential Risks from Contaminated Chlorella

The primary concern regarding liver harm from chlorella is the risk of contamination with toxic substances.

  • Microcystins and Anatoxins: Certain types of blue-green algae can be contaminated with these highly toxic substances. The side effects of ingesting contaminated algae can be severe and include liver damage, stomach pain, nausea, vomiting, and in rare cases, death. It is essential to only purchase chlorella from reputable manufacturers that test their products for toxins and heavy metals.

Other Chlorella Side Effects Not Directly Liver-Related

For most people, side effects are mild and primarily gastrointestinal. They tend to occur during the first week of use as the body adjusts to the supplement. Common side effects include:

  • Nausea and stomach cramps
  • Diarrhea or green-colored stools
  • Bloating and gas
  • Increased skin sensitivity to the sun

Who Should Exercise Caution?

Certain individuals should be particularly careful when taking chlorella:

  • Individuals with Autoimmune Diseases: Chlorella may stimulate the immune system, which could potentially worsen the symptoms of autoimmune diseases such as multiple sclerosis, lupus, or rheumatoid arthritis.
  • Those on Immunosuppressive Medication: Because chlorella stimulates the immune system, it can interfere with immunosuppressive drugs.
  • People with Iodine Sensitivity or Thyroid Issues: Chlorella can contain iodine, which might cause an allergic reaction in sensitive individuals or affect those with hyperactive thyroidism.
  • Those on Blood-Thinning Medications: Chlorella contains vitamin K, which can interfere with the effectiveness of blood-thinning drugs like warfarin.
  • Pregnant or Breast-feeding Women: There is insufficient evidence to determine the safety of chlorella for these individuals.

Chlorella vs. Spirulina: A Comparative Look

Both chlorella and spirulina are popular microalgae supplements, but they have distinct differences in their nutritional profiles and potential effects. This table outlines some key comparisons, particularly regarding liver-related uses.

Feature Chlorella Spirulina
Cell Wall Thick, tough cell wall that requires processing ('cracked' or 'broken cell wall') to make nutrients bioavailable and aid detoxification. Easily digestible cell wall.
Detoxification Strong heavy metal binding and detoxification properties. Often preferred for liver and body detoxification. Less noted for heavy metal detoxification compared to chlorella.
Liver Support Studies indicate potential benefits for fatty liver disease (NAFLD) by improving liver enzymes and metabolic markers. Offers some antioxidant support for liver function.
Nutrient Density Rich in chlorophyll, vitamin A, iron, magnesium, and zinc. Higher in beta-carotene and phycocyanin.
Primary Use Often sought for liver and heavy metal detoxification. Often used for boosting energy and athletic performance.
Contamination Risk Requires careful sourcing to avoid contamination with toxins. Can also be contaminated with toxins if not sourced properly.
